The Parallel Breakdown

Now, where things get really exciting for collectors is in the parallel game. The 2025 Topps Marvel Studios set offers a dizzying array of numbered parallels for Agent Maria Hill #30, allowing for a truly personalized chase. Let's break down what each of these means for your collection:

  • /199: This is often your first step into rarity. A solid, relatively accessible numbered parallel that signifies a limited print run, making it more special than the base card.
  • /150: A slightly tighter print run than the /199, offering a bit more exclusivity without being overly difficult to track down.
  • /99: We're now dipping into double-digit print runs. These are getting noticeably scarcer and are a great target for collectors looking for a mid-tier rarity.
  • /80, /76, /75: These are fascinating, often hinting at specific anniversaries, character connections, or other thematic elements within the set. The /76 and /75, in particular, suggest a very specific, perhaps even subtle, nod to Marvel lore or release dates. These are the kind of details that make collecting so engaging.
  • /50, /50-2: When you see two different parallels with the same print run, it usually means distinct visual treatments. One might be a specific color, while the other is a different pattern or finish. Both are highly desirable, being limited to just 50 copies each.
  • /49: An even tighter run than the /50s, making this a true low-numbered gem.
  • /25, /25-2: These are serious pulls. With only 25 copies of each, these are considered highly rare and are often sought after by set builders and character collectors alike. Again, expect distinct visual differences between the two.
  • /10, /10-2: Now we're talking about ultra-rarity. Only ten copies of each exist! These are grail-level cards for many, and finding one is a significant accomplishment.
  • /5, /5-2: The penultimate tier of rarity. With only five copies, these are incredibly scarce and command significant attention on the secondary market. A true chase for the dedicated collector.
  • /1 (The 1-of-1): The absolute pinnacle. The Holy Grail. The one-of-one parallel is the rarest card in the entire set for Agent Maria Hill. Owning this means you possess the only copy in existence, making it a cornerstone for any serious collection and a truly legendary find.

Agent Maria Hill Marvel's The Avengers Phase One in 2025 Topps Marvel Studios

Agent Maria Hill's inclusion in the 2025 Topps Marvel Studios set, specifically for The Avengers Phase One, is a testament to her enduring importance in the MCU. While she might not have superpowers, her intelligence, loyalty, and tactical prowess made her an indispensable figure during the early, chaotic days of the Avengers Initiative. She was Nick Fury's rock, the voice of reason, and a critical operational mind. For Marvel card collectors, characters like Maria Hill represent the backbone of the Marvel universe – the human element that grounds the fantastical. Her cards are often undervalued compared to the main heroes, but they offer incredible value and a unique collecting proposition for those who appreciate the wider tapestry of the MCU.
